    Survival Medicine Class April 7th 2013
    Orlando, FL

    JRH first began hosting Survival Medicine classes in 1993. Back by popular demand we are offering half day blocks of instruction and full day classes on Survival Medicine.

    April 7th, 2013 class will cover-


    Morning Session---
    Patient Assessment:
    Understand the A,B,C,D and E of the primary assessment
    What to look for when performing a secondary survey
    Compare and contrast results from primary assessment for trauma and medical patients
    Understand the importance of vital signs when related to trauma patients

    Airway Management:
    Understand the respiratory anatomy
    Learn the common causes of airway obstruction
    Learn and practice the basic airway management techniques
    Compare and contrast nasopharyngeal vs. oropharyngeal airways

    Shock Management:
    Learn the reasons for shock and various types of shock
    Practice the stabilization and management of the patient with shock

    If time permits, we will review the items needed and the procedure for needle chricothyrotomy.

    Afternoon Session----
    Basic Trauma Overview:
    Understand blood loss and hemorrhage control
    Learn and practice basic bandaging techniques
    Review the basic kinetics of trauma and why they are important in patient care
    Review the basic anatomy of internal organs
    Compare and contrast the differences in trauma to different internal organs
    Review shock management from morning session
    Soft tissue injuries including burns
    Basis Fracture management

    If time permits we will review the items needed and procedure for needle thoracostomy.

    Even though these are separate "classes", sessions are designed to be "built" upon. A participant that attends the first session will have a better understanding during session two.
    Both sessions will include hands on practice and if time permits, different scenarios will be practiced.
